Rating: ![5 stars](http://www.reviewfocus.com/images/stars-5-0.gif) Summary: Laudatory! Review: This book helped me learn the words necessary to achieve a noteworthy score on the SAT. The book is broken up into 35 lessons. Each lesson revolves around a theme to which all of the listed words relate to. This helps the reader remember the words easier. At first, I was skeptical. This book seemed like a bunch of words lists to me. But the grouping of similar words actually helped me remember more words. Looking over the book, there are only about 10 I don't know of the 350+ words. I would recommend this book to those who wish to improve their verbal SAT score. P.S.-If you didn't know what laudatory meant, it's in the book.

Rating: ![5 stars](http://www.reviewfocus.com/images/stars-5-0.gif) Summary: SAT Verbal Breakthrough Review: This book is a must buy!!! I've been an SAT instructor for a long time and this is the best book for the verbal section! This will boost your vocab like nothing else!!! There are three sentences made for each vocab word so you "really" understand the meaning of each word. It's not just a list of words and their definitions and you have to memorize it. Words being used in sentences really aid the memory and will totally boost your scores on the SAT!!! I highly recommend it. (...)

Rating: ![2 stars](http://www.reviewfocus.com/images/stars-2-0.gif) Summary: Disappointed Review: This updated version of the text has been torturous for my current 9th grade students. Carnevale's practice exercises contain flaws and typos and obscure language not age-appropriate for most 9th and 10th grade students. Word groupings ensure that a good number within each lesson are synonymous or what's worse, nearly so, making it difficult for students to keep words and their definitions distinct. It is also difficult to quiz students on these words because they are so closely related in meaning. Our school will not be using this text again.
